Abstract
BACKGROUND: Enhanced Recovery After Surgery (ERAS) programs emphasize multimodal analgesia to minimize opioid use and improve patient outcomes. Continuous wound infiltration (CWI) with local analgesic is a promising adjunct to multimodal analgesia. However, its benefits in minimally invasive procedures and ERAS-adherent care remain unknown. This trial investigates whether the addition of CWI to standard ERAS care improves postoperative recovery following minimally invasive colorectal surgery. METHODS: In this single-centre, blinded, randomised controlled trial, 192 eligible patients are randomised to receive either a CWI system with bupivacaine 0.125% (the interventional arm), or a placebo CWI with physiological saline (the control arm). All patients receive standardized ERAS perioperative care with multimodal analgesia. The primary outcome is the Quality of Recovery-15 score (QoR-15NL) on postoperative day 2. Secondary outcomes include QoR-15NL and pain scores (postoperative days 1-5), opioid consumption, length of hospital stay, key functional recovery milestones, and 90-day postoperative complications. DISCUSSION: This will be the first randomised controlled trial evaluating the effect of CWI within minimally invasive and ERAS-adherent colorectal surgery. The trial findings may improve evidence-based perioperative care guidelines and enhance postoperative multimodal analgesia.
